Code § 18-34-2","heading":"Policy enacted.","body":"(a) A student’s absence due to a student’s pregnancy or parenting needs is an excused absence as provided under this section and for purposed of §18-8-4(a)(1) of this code.\n(b) The State Board of Education shall develop a written attendance policy for pregnant and parenting students that, at a minimum, meets the requirements of this article. The policy developed under this section shall:\n(1) Excuse all absences due to pregnancy or parenting-related conditions, including absences for:\n(A) Labor;\n(B) Delivery;\n(C) Recovery; and\n(D) Prenatal and postnatal medical appointments;\n(2) Provide at least 8 weeks of excused absences for a mother for the birth of the student’s child, including both natural/vaginal delivery and c-section delivery;\n(3) Provide excused absences for antenatal care by recommendation of the medical provider;\n(4) Provide two weeks excused absence for the father of the child;\n(A) A doctor’s or medical excuse shall be provided up to the initial 8 weeks' absence and a separate excuse for each period of absence after the initial 8 weeks.\n(B) County boards shall make reasonable efforts to encourage the parent to remain on track for graduation by providing academic support options including, but not limited to, work provided virtually and a homebound instructor for weekly visits to ensure accountability.\n(5) Provide an excused absence for parenting students whose children are sick: Provided, That they shall provide a doctor’s excuse for that child.\n(6) The schools shall refer the pregnant and parenting student to a \"pregnancy help organization\" by providing a list of pregnancy or postpartum assistance organizations within the county and surrounding counties as defined under §16-66-1 of this code.","path":["CHAPTER 18.
